Professional HVAC System Maintenance Services in Calgary
HVAC System Maintenance keeps heating and cooling systems inspected, cleaned, and tuned so they run reliably. Homeowners, landlords, and small businesses schedule maintenance to avoid mid-winter failures and to keep indoor air healthier.
Calgary's temperature swings and chinook-driven dust make filters clog faster than in many cities, so routine checks stop motor strain and heat exchanger stress. For older infill homes near Sunnyside or Mount Royal, we often find duct joints that need sealing to stop energy loss.
DIY filter swaps help, but professional maintenance uses specialized vacuums, coil brushes, and airflow testing to catch issues early. That difference matters when you're prepping a furnace for a -20°C snap or checking a heat pump ahead of a summer warm spell.
Benefits of Regular HVAC System Maintenance
- Improved Air Quality: Regular filter changes and duct cleaning lower dust and allergens in homes near construction corridors like Kensington.
- Fewer Breakdowns: Scheduled inspections catch worn belts and failing capacitors before a cold snap causes a system outage.
- Better Efficiency: Clean coils and sealed ducts reduce blower time, which helps systems run more efficiently during Calgary's long heating season.
- Longer Equipment Life: Routine lubrication and calibration reduce wear on motors and compressors, extending unit lifespan.
- Clear Documentation: Service reports help landlords in neighbourhoods like Beltline and Bridgeland track maintenance for tenants and inspections.
- Safety Checks: Combustion and venting checks reduce carbon monoxide risks in older boilers common in inner-city properties.

System Inspection
We check thermostats, electrical connections, and safety controls. Our technicians document findings and note parts that may need future replacement.
Filter Service
We replace or clean filters based on manufacturer specs and indoor air needs. That step reduces dust build-up on coils and in ducts.
Duct Assessment
We perform a visual duct inspection, check for leaks, and recommend sealing where leakage reduces performance, especially in houses with uninsulated crawlspaces.
Coil and Blower Cleaning
Cleaning coils and blower assemblies restores airflow, lowers energy use, and reduces compressor strain during Calgary's long heating months.

Warning Signs to Watch For
Not sure if you need HVAC System Maintenance? Here are warning signs Calgary homeowners and businesses should watch for:
- Rising Energy Bills: A system that runs longer each cycle often needs cleaning or adjustment; local cold snaps can expose inefficiency.
- Uneven Heating: Rooms near the northeast side of older homes can stay cooler when ducts leak or registers clog.
- Weak Airflow: Clogged coils or dirty blower wheels commonly reduce airflow after winter in Calgary.
- Dust Build-up: Heavy dust on vents after a construction season in Beltline often signals ducts need inspection.
- Frequent Cycling: Short on/off cycles can indicate thermostat or refrigerant issues needing professional checks.
- Odd Noises: New rattles or squeals after a chinook wind event suggest loose components or motor wear.

Understanding Local Cost Factors
The cost of HVAC System Maintenance in Calgary varies based on several factors:
System Type
Furnace-only systems typically take less time than combined furnace and central air systems, which increases labour and inspection scope.
Access & Duct Condition
Tight attic access or badly sealed ducts increase time on site and may require additional sealing materials or labor.
Parts & Filters
Older units may need OEM parts or larger filters, which raises material costs and affects scheduling.
Seasonal Demand
Peak seasons in Calgary push lead times and labour rates; booking off-peak in spring or fall can reduce wait time.
